    Firebrand is a 2023 British historical drama film directed by Karim Aïnouz and written by Henrietta Ashworth and Jessica Ashworth, based on the 2013 novel Queen's Gambit by Elizabeth Fremantle. The film focuses on Katherine Parr, Queen of England, the sixth wife of Henry VIII. It stars Alicia Vikander, Jude Law, and Eddie Marsan. The film ...
